Integumentary System

An organ system responsible for protection, water retention, temperature regulation, fat storage, sensation, and vitamin D; consists of the skin, hair, nails, and cutaneous glands.

Skeletal System

An organ system responsible for support, mineral storage, and blood-cell production; consists of bones, cartilage, and ligaments.

Muscular System

An organ system responsible for movement, posture, balance, controlling openings, and heat generation; consists of skeletal, smooth, and cardiac muscle.

Nervous System

An organ system that senses the environment, provides rapid communication, and handles motor control; consists of the brain, spinal cord, nerves, and ganglia.

Endocrine System

An organ system responsible for hormones and chemical communication; consists of the pituitary, pineal, adrenal, thyroid, testicles, hypo, parathyroids, ovaries, thymus, and pancreas.

Cardiovascular System

An organ system that transports nutrients, O2O_2, wastes, hormones, etc.; consists of the heart, arteries, veins, and capillaries.

Lymphatic System

An organ system responsible for immune cell production, immune infection defense, and fluid recovery; consists of the thymus, spleen, lymph nodes, konsils, lymph vessels, and appendix.

Respiratory System

An organ system responsible for gas exchange that brings in O2O_2 and removes CO2CO_2; consists of the lungs, bronchi, bronchioles, alveoli, nose, tracnea, pharynx, and larynx.

Digestive System

An organ system that breaks down food so cells can absorb it; consists of the mouth, teeth, tongue, esophagus, stomach, intestines, rectum, anus, liver, pancreas, salivary glands, and gallbladder.
